Local ingredients meet exotic flair at Vancouver World Chef Exchange

Winter in Vancouver is perfect for cozying up and indulging in nourishing dishes fresh from the earth - especially when the kitchen team is visited by an acclaimed overseas chef. On Monday, January 22, Burdock & Co will host an exclusive Dine Out Vancouver Festival event - part of the 2018 Vancouver World Chef Exchange - which treats diners to a multi-course feast prepared by Executive Chef Andrea Carlson in collaboration with Chef Fumihiro Matsumoto and Sommelier Kenji Kawamura of Kantera Restaurant in Tokyo.
 
Chefs Carlson and Matsumoto will ignite the Burdock & Co dining room with visually stunning and impeccably flavoured dishes. The one-night-only menu will combine Burdock & Co's contemporary West Coast cuisine with Kantera's authentic Japanese flair, creating an east-meets-west dining experience of palate-pleasing surprises and delights. Sommelier Jesse Walters and Mr. Kawamura will curate sake and natural wine pairings to complement each course. Guests can select from two seatings, each lasting 2.5 hours; the first begins at 5:45pm, and the second at 8:30pm.
 
"I was recently in Japan, and on our first night we happened upon Kantera. It was the most amazing dining experience, and we returned again at the end of our trip" says Chef Carlson. "Like myself and Jesse, Mr. Kawamura is a natural wine enthusiast and he shared with us a selection of incredible local wines. It is an honour to team up with him and Chef Matsumoto for this special evening."
 
Each item on the event's exclusive menu will blend Chefs Carlson and Matsumoto's favourite culinary inspirations while incorporating sustainable seafood and ingredients grown in B.C. Tickets cost $203.75 per person and include the multi-course dinner, welcome cocktail, wine pairings, tax, gratuity and ticketing fees. Limited seating is available, so interested diners are encouraged to reserve tickets online through Tickets Tonight before the event sells out. Kitchen bar seats are available on a first-come, first-served basis.  Please arrive early for your reservation to receive seats at the bar.
